NYT: Dean Vermont Energy Group Met in Private

It's actually an AP story.
Apparently, written by some kind of weasel, it attempts to equate Dean's actions in Vermont with Cheney's in Washington.

"Democratic presidential contender Howard Dean has demanded release of secret deliberations of Vice President Dick Cheney's energy task force. But as Vermont governor, Dean had an energy task force that met in secret and angered state lawmakers."

"The parallels between the Cheney and Dean task forces are many."

Apparently, many = three, and one of those three is dubious.

"Both declined to open their deliberations, even under pressure from legislators. Both received input from the energy industry in private meetings, and released the names of task force members publicly."

The article then goes on to contrast Dean's actions with those of Cheney for better than half of the (web) page, providing support to this statement, made early in the article:

"Dean said his group developed better policy, was bipartisan and sought advice not just from energy executives but environmentalists and low-income advocates. He said his task force was more open because it held one public hearing and divulged afterward the names of people it consulted even though the content of discussions with them was kept secret."
